新的javascript / jquery库允许对JSON数据进行类似SQL的查询?

时间:2012-01-23 02:45:32

标签: javascript json

大约一年前曾向date提出这个问题。正如我已经谷歌搜索这个问题的答案,我发现的所有图书馆似乎都没有任何活动大约一年。我只是想知道是否有人知道目前维护的任何库,或人们做了什么其他选择?

我希望做一些客户端数据过滤,除了编写自己的函数之外,我还可以接受其他建议。

2 个答案:

答案 0 :(得分:0)

您可能需要查看taffydbweb sql database

答案 1 :(得分:0)

您可以尝试使用Alasql JavaScript库。它支持具有完整SQL功能的JSON数组上的查询。

以下是示例:

 <script src="alasql.min.js"></script>
 <script>
     var cars = [{model:'Mazda', price:20000}, {model:'Toyota', price:25000}, 
        {model:'Ford', price:22000}];

     var res = alasql("SELECT * FROM ? WHERE price > 21000",[cars]);

     console.log(res);
 </script>

试试这个例子in jsFiddle